The Cardiovascular Nurse Practitioner will collaborate with specialists holding specialty board certifications across interventional cardiology, electrophysiology, nuclear cardiology, echocardiography, lipidology, and advanced heart failure. Advanced diagnostics available to support Nurse Practitioner Cardiology practice include non-invasive testing, cardiac CT, echocardiography, and nuclear cardiology, enabling evidence-based treatment plans and continuity of care across the cardiac continuum.

Reporting to the Medical Director of Cardiology and aligned closely with collaborative cardiologists and advanced practice providers, the Cardiology Nurse Practitioner will evaluate, diagnose, and manage acute and chronic cardiovascular conditions in both outpatient and select inpatient settings. The Cardiovascular Nurse Practitioner will be supported by experienced registered nurses, cardiac technologists, medical assistants, and a multidisciplinary team that includes pharmacy, rehabilitation services, and case management.
